Alleged Peeping Tom Arrested At Santa Clara Valley Medical Center: Sheriff's Office
Sheriff's deputies arrested 25-year-old San Jose resident Fereja Ali on Monday evening and charged him with peeping at a South Bay hospital.

SANTA CLARA COUNTY, CA -- Sheriff's deputies on Monday evening arrested a 25-year-old man suspected of peeping at a South Bay hospital that he worked at.
San Jose resident Fereja Ali was arrested April 10 on suspicion of peeping, and is being held on $5,000 bail, sheriff's officials said.
Ali was allegedly peeping at Santa Clara Valley Medical Center, located at 751 S. Bascom Ave. in unincorporated San Jose.

He allegedly looked through an exterior window into a non-patient area designated for security staff, according to sheriff's Sgt. Rich Glennon.
He has worked as a protective services officer at the hospital since January 2016, according to his LinkedIn profile.
